moist apple bread cinnamon (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Bread Base

01 - 1/2 cup soft, unsalted butter
02 - 2 big eggs
03 - 2 teaspoons pure vanilla
04 - 1 1/2 cups plain flour
05 - 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
06 - 1/2 cup regular milk
07 - 2/3 cup white sugar

→ Filling

08 - 1 large apple, peeled and diced up small
09 - 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
10 - 1/2 cup light brown sugar, packed

→ Icing

11 - 2 tablespoons milk
12 - 1 cup powdered sugar
13 - 1/2 teaspoon vanilla

# Instructions:

01 - Toss brown sugar with cinnamon in a little bowl. Smear butter or spray inside a 9x5 loaf pan and shake around a bit of flour. Set oven to 350°F.
02 - Cream butter and sugar until kind of fluffy. Toss in eggs and vanilla. Pour in flour, baking powder, then the milk—blend it all up.
03 - Drop in half the batter, sprinkle over half the apple pieces and generous cinnamon sugar. Do it all again with the rest.
04 - Push the topping down into the mix just a bit. Cook it for about 50 minutes. When it springs back, pull from oven and let sit in the pan for 10 minutes.
05 - Stir icing stuff in a cup till taken together and smooth. Splash icing over the cooled loaf.

# Notes:

01 - Loves a tangy baking apple best
02 - Freeze whole or just slices
03 - Stays soft wrapped up on the counter
